Job Description
We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Remote Technical Writer to join our dynamic team. In this 100% remote role, you will be responsible for creating, editing, and maintaining high-quality technical documentation, including user manuals, installation guides, API documentation, online help, and release notes for our cutting-edge software products. You will work closely with product managers, engineers, and support teams to ensure accuracy, clarity, and consistency across all documentation, making complex technical information easily understandable for diverse audiences.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and maintain comprehensive technical documentation, including user manuals, administration guides, release notes, and online help systems.
- Collaborate with engineering, product management, and support teams to gather information, understand product features, and define documentation requirements.
- Translate complex technical concepts into clear, concise, and accurate content for both technical and non-technical audiences.
- Ensure documentation adheres to established style guides, terminology, and branding standards.
- Manage documentation through the entire lifecycle, from planning and drafting to review, publication, and ongoing updates.
- Proactively identify opportunities to improve documentation processes and tools.
- Participate in product design and development discussions to advocate for user experience and documentation needs.
